1. What is a Rock Header Machine?

A Rock Header Machine is a specialized piece of equipment used primarily for rock drilling and excavation. Unlike traditional drilling rigs, which might use a rotary mechanism, the Rock Header Machine typically employs a more powerful, efficient hydraulic system that allows it to break through hard rock more effectively.

2. What are the key advantages of a Rock Header Machine over traditional drilling?

There are several significant advantages of using a Rock Header Machine:

  1. Efficiency: The Rock Header Machine is designed to handle tough material more quickly than traditional drills. Its faster operation can reduce the overall time required for a drilling project.
  2. Precision: This machine offers better control and accuracy, which is particularly useful in complex drilling tasks or when precise measurements are necessary.
  3. Lower Operational Costs: Although the initial investment may be higher, the efficiency and speed of the Rock Header Machine can lead to lower labor costs and reduced downtime.
  4. Less Noise and Vibration: Compared to traditional drills, Rock Header Machines may produce less noise and vibration, making them more environmentally friendly and suitable for urban environments.

3. In what situations is a Rock Header Machine preferable to traditional drilling methods?

A Rock Header Machine is often preferable in specific scenarios:

  1. Hard Rock Conditions: When drilling in very hard rock formations, the Rock Header Machine excels due to its powerful design.
  2. Construction Projects: Many construction sites that require precise excavation and minimal disturbance to surrounding areas benefit from using this type of machine.
  3. Long-Term Projects: For intensive and prolonged drilling jobs, the efficiency of the Rock Header Machine can lead to cost savings and quicker project completion.

4. Are there disadvantages to using a Rock Header Machine?

While there are many advantages, there are also some drawbacks to consider:

  1. High Initial Cost: Purchasing or renting a Rock Header Machine can be significantly more expensive than traditional drilling equipment.
  2. Specialized Training Required: Operators must receive specific training to handle the machine effectively, which can incur additional costs and time.
  3. Maintenance Needs: Some Rock Header Machines may require more specialized and costly maintenance compared to traditional drills.

5. When should you choose traditional drilling methods instead?

In certain cases, traditional drilling methods may be more appropriate:

  1. Soft or Loose Soil: For projects involving primarily loose soil or softer rock, traditional drills might be adequate and more cost-effective.
  2. Smaller Projects: In small-scale jobs or DIY projects, the simplicity and cost of traditional drills may be more appealing.
  3. Regional Limitations: In areas lacking access to advanced machinery or in remote locations, traditional drilling equipment may be the only option available.

Conclusion

In summary, the choice between a Rock Header Machine and traditional drilling greatly depends on the project's specific requirements and conditions. While the Rock Header Machine offers numerous benefits such as speed, precision, and efficiency in hard rock conditions, it is essential to weigh these against the potential drawbacks and the suitability of traditional methods for particular projects.
